How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Northside Binghamton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Northside Binghamton Studio Apartments | $450 | $450 | $450 |
| Northside Binghamton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,034 | $650 | $1,522 |
| Northside Binghamton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,358 | $775 | $3,400 |
| Northside Binghamton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,749 | $475 | $2,535 |
| Northside Binghamton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,628 | $775 | $3,800 |
| Northside Binghamton 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,193 | $660 | $4,125 |
| Northside Binghamton 6 Bedroom Apartments | $5,606 | $3,750 | $10,000+ |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Northside Binghamton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$1,431 | $950 | $1,600 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$2,066 | $1,295 | $2,985 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$2,815 | $1,050 | $3,900 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$3,825 | $3,125 | $4,375 |
| 6 Bedroom Homes | $5,019 | $2,850 | $7,500 |
| 7 Bedroom Homes | $600 | $600 | $600 |
